CarPlay/AndroidAuto connection lost at toll barriers

Every time I arrived at a French or Italian toll barriers the connection between car and phone was lost.
Has anyone else encountered this?

Been home a week from a trip around France, Italy, Germany and Switzerland and passed many Tolls on French motorways without issue.

I was using the "Liber-t tag" for tolls, which fits neatly into the slot in the plastic below the rear view mirror. Car and phone connection via the USB A connection in the arm rest.

Are you using the phone with wired connection or wireless?

I do however lose connection most of the time that I turn off the ignition and restart with the phone connected. I have to unplug it and plug it in again.

Also lost sat nav and Waze a couple of times for no reason and it took between 30mins and an hour. May have been confused with the hairpins! :ROFLMAO:

I put the tag completely out of sight behind the mirror shroud, in the triangle space where the adas camera would go and it worked fine.

IMG_8277.jpeg


But I also had the carplay/waze freezing at toll booths issue.

Only occasionally. When it happened, coming out of carplay to the car menu and back would fix it, but one time the settings and carplay icons disappeared and only a car switch off solved it.

I wonder if its anything to do with the tag transmitting to the tollbooth?
Be interesting to know if anyone not using the tag has issues.

This is an issue in Australia. Apple Play shuts off for about two seconds every time we go through a toll booth.
Suspect it's something to do with the radio frequency used for toll transmission.

Just came back from Le Mans in France. I was using google maps via apple car play. I don’t have a tag. When I stopped at the barrier to pay with my credit card the route disappeared and I had to restart it. Now I know why. The tag reader must be broadcasting with a strong signal to cause that.

CarPlay uses Bluetooth and WiFi in combination. RFID blasting under toll booths and possibly modern electronic signs on highways probably wreak havoc with either or both.
Some cars seem to be more sensitive to this. I suspect the Emiras WiFi to not be set up too well. Upon entering the car Bluetooth connects instantly, but CarPlay will have no chance to connect until after 30-40s. I guess that’s the time needed to boot up the internal WiFi network (might be a hidden one).
I'm going to figure out how long the wifi takes to get ready after cold & dark startup too

Cool!!!! Great idea!!!! I want to do the same! I hate having things attached to the windscreen of the car.... how did you do that?
Very easy.

Pop off the mirror shroud and just stick the tag holder to the glass in the triangle space.

To get the shroud off, first pull off the small section directly above the mirror by hooking something through the vents and pulling back. Then use a trim tool or similar to lever the main section downwards, front first. It’s only clipped on.

I had the exact same problem at more less the same route you took. Only at the French and Italian toll stations I lost connection.
Leaving the toll booth and it comes on on its own after a couple of second.
My setup
Wireless Android Auto, no tracker or anything else. Samsung S21 Ultra.
I believe either their bluetooth or wifi is interfering. I also believe that a setting on the phone should keep the Emira connection as priority. I did not fiddle around as it did not bother me, but I guess it is the phone "searching" for other networks, not the Emira.
Otherwise wireless Android Auto works all the time without any problem, connects so fast that it is up and running when sitting in the car. It starts connecting when you open the door.
